Transaction 57bf31f286949f33f1daf9b9271fdc81b5f6ea77f34ba3b451d0a902a1d94761
2 Input
2 Outputs
- 57bf31f286949f33f1daf9b9271fdc81b5f6ea77f34ba3b451d0a902a1d94761:0
- 57bf31f286949f33f1daf9b9271fdc81b5f6ea77f34ba3b451d0a902a1d94761:1
value 953510
address 12r5Z6ZDPNndC5mCe9SSZ1oS92wCmbUhYU
value 10000
address 1MVKcwLfGV8BBp9ZYaYegpBdzGEs4QmEFW